Method. Share is each chain’s portion of total category store visits, resolved deterministically from opt-in device visits across ~74.6M U.S. households. Change is same-store (only locations active in both periods) and outlier-trimmed, so it reflects real visitation rather than coverage or panel changes; it is category-relative, which controls for seasonality and panel growth. Comparison is H2 2024 vs H2 2025. Aggregate and k-anonymous — never PII. Movement reflects both creative and media weight and is not attributed to creative alone.
